As quoted from another thread:
Code:
Splash Flasher Instructions ... (I am not responsible for damage done to your phone , use this at your own risk !)

1: Place image of your choice into the place-image-here folder (Ignore this as I already placed it in the folder for you)
2: Click on CLICK-HERE
3: DISREGARD the 480x800 warning this tool works just fine with 540x960 Images .
4: Follow on screen instructions theyre very easy .
5: Enjoy

From what I have understood from other posts, it is that governors when used with the dualcore script tends to cause instability and battery drain. I haven't enabled the "always on (dualcore)" script because it is still in its early stages and will just eat away at your battery for now. After using smartass governor I haven't noticed any difference in battery, but at the same time I haven't noticed any battery being saved (Which is what it should be doing). I'll probably relook at everything pretty soon and see what is the best choice for my rom to have.
